: Agony, the most common symptom described among the clients in the key treatment location, is intricate to control. Opioids are One of the most strong analgesics agents for controlling discomfort. Considering that the mid-nineteen nineties, the quantity of opioid prescriptions for that management of Persistent non-cancer pain (CNCP) has greater by greater than 400%, which amplified availability has drastically contributed to opioid diversion, overdose, tolerance, dependence, and addiction. Regardless of the questionable success of opioids in managing CNCP and their substantial premiums of side effects, the absence of available different prescription drugs as well as their scientific restrictions and slower onset of action has triggered an overreliance on opioids.

Conolidine is surely an indole alkaloid derived within the bark in the tropical flowering shrub Tabernaemontana divaricate Utilized in common Chinese, Ayurvedic, and Thai drugs. Conolidine could stand for the start of a brand new period of Serious agony administration. It is now being investigated for its effects around the atypical chemokine receptor (ACK3). Inside a rat design, it was observed that a competitor molecule binding to ACKR3 resulted in inhibition of ACKR3’s inhibitory action, leading to an Over-all increase in opiate receptor exercise. Even though the identification of conolidine as a potential novel analgesic agent supplies an extra avenue to deal with the opioid crisis and handle CNCP, even further scientific studies are essential to be aware of its system of motion and utility and efficacy in handling CNCP.

Most recently, it has been determined that conolidine and the above mentioned derivatives act within the atypical chemokine receptor three (ACKR3. Expressed in related regions as classical opioid receptors, it binds to some big range of endogenous opioids. Unlike most opioid receptors, this receptor functions as a scavenger and would not activate a second messenger procedure (fifty nine). As discussed by Meyrath et al., this also indicated a probable hyperlink involving these receptors as well as the endogenous opiate technique (fifty nine). This research ultimately determined which the ACKR3 receptor didn't generate any G protein sign response by measuring and obtaining no mini G protein interactions, contrary to classical opiate receptors, which recruit these proteins for signaling.

, also referred to as pinwheel flower or crepe jasmine, has extended been used in classic Chinese, Ayurvedic and Thai medicines to treat fever and pain4 (Fig. 1a). Pharmacologists have only a short while ago been equipped to verify its medicinal and pharmacological Attributes owing to its first asymmetric complete synthesis.five Conolidine is usually a rare C5-nor stemmadenine (Fig. 1b), which shows strong analgesia in in vivo products of tonic and persistent agony and minimizes inflammatory soreness aid. It had been also recommended that conolidine-induced analgesia could lack difficulties generally connected to classical opioid prescription drugs.5 Apparently, conolidine was observed being current at micromolar amounts during the brain after systemic injection5 but was unable to set off immediate activation of classical opioid receptors, notably MOR, and so was not categorised being an “opioid drug”.

Elucidating the specific pharmacological mechanism of motion (MOA) of Normally transpiring compounds is often challenging. Despite the fact that Tarselli et al. (60) designed the first de novo synthetic pathway to conolidine and showcased that this By natural means occurring compound efficiently suppresses responses to both of those chemically induced and inflammation-derived suffering, the pharmacologic focus on answerable for its antinociceptive motion remained elusive. Given the troubles associated with normal pharmacological and physiological ways, Mendis et al. used cultured neuronal networks grown on multi-electrode array (MEA) technological know-how coupled with sample matching reaction profiles to provide a possible MOA of conolidine (sixty one).
